Why You Need Earplugs

After leaving a venue, your ears might feel muffled or you could notice a ringing noise. The ringing is known as tinnitus- it’s the first indicator of hearing damage. Venues are usually louder than 100 dBs, while your ears can only handle around 85 dBs. 

That means, your hearing is at risk each time you go to a festival or concert. If you want to protect your ears, you should wear foam earplugs each time that you go. It’s important to find earplugs that lower the decibels reaching your ears by at least 20 dBs.

Take Sound Breaks

Next, you’ll want to take breaks after the concert. A good rule of thumb is an hour of sound, then take a break. During that time, you can wander the venue- find snacks, drinks, or a cool T-shirt. Plus, you can use the bathroom and stretch.

After the concert, you should let your ears rest for a few days. That means, no loud music at home. It can be very tempting, but your ears will appreciate the break. By doing this, you won’t experience hearing loss after the concert is over.

Prepare Your Ears

You can also prepare your ears the week before the concert by giving them a break. Hearing damage is very gradual and builds up over time. If you know you’ll be at a venue soon, then you should be careful with your ears the week before. 

It’s very easy to rest your ears. Instead of using earbuds to listen to music at home, listen through your device’s speakers. That way, there’s more distance between your ears and the sound. Plus, you should also make sure to listen at a quieter volume than you normally would.
